将线或多边形部分从单元格数组转换为向量形式
[lat,lon] = polyjoin(latcells,loncells)
[lat,lon] = polyjoin(latcells,loncells)
将多边形从单元格数组格式转换为列向量格式。在单元格数组格式中,单元格数组的每个元素都是定义一个单独多边形的向量。
Latcells = {[1 2 3]';4;[5 6 7 8 NaN 9]'};Loncells = {[9 8 7]';6;[5 4 3 2 NaN 1]'};[lat,lon] = polyjoin(latcells,loncells);[lat lon] ans = 1 9 2 8 3 7 NaN NaN 4 6 NaN NaN 5 5 6 4 7 3 8 2 NaN NaN 9 1
一个多边形可以由一个外轮廓和几个孔组成南
s.在向量格式中,每个向量可以包含多个面南
s.在矢量格式中,外轮廓和孔之间没有结构上的区别。